Cash game 6 / 9

I prefer to play in 6-player tables and zoom, when I started playing poker, the first time I played the money, I figured that with 9 players it was better because the blinds take longer to get past you and wait for a hand to play. problem is that when it comes AA or KK you hardly get called from someone, because the vast majority are waiting for the hands premiuns.

I think for aggressive players 6-max is the better version cause you can apply more pressure and triple barrels work out more frequently

For tight players I think their advantage are the big fields and 9 maxs cause they know which hands they play and will be patient to not get punted off and bust

With 6 players the knob spins faster but you have fewer opponents to take game readings and the variance decreases.
With nine players the knob rotates slower, their blinds are consumed with less speed, but they are more players to read and a little more variance.
Still overall I prefer the tables with 9 players.

9-max teaches you discipline and preflop hand selection, 6-max gives you more opportunity to play with speculative hands, but comes with more variance. Really, it depends on your style. I'd recommend 9-max for beginners / those players, who also play rather serious tournaments, whereas 6-max is more action-packed. Having the ability to adjust between the two is always good, of course.
